Today is Thursday, April 15, the 105th day of 2010. There are 260 days left in the year.
1729 _ Johann S. Bach's ``Matthew's Passion" premieres in Leipzig
1738 _ Bottle opener invented
1861 _ Federal army (75,000 volunteers) mobilized by President Abraham Lincoln
1896 _ First Olympic games close at Athens, Greece
1900 _ International Exposition opens in Paris, France
1911 _ Walter Johnson pitches a record-tying four strike outs in an inning
1912 _ Titanic sinks at 2:27 a.m. in North Atlantic as the band plays on
1945 _ FDR buried on grounds of Hyde Park home
1981 _ Janet Cooke says her Pulitzer award 8-year-old heroin addict story is a lie, Washington Post relinquishes Pulitzer Prize on fabricated story
1985 _ South Africa will repeal sex and marriage laws against whites & non-whites
